A slight decrease in number from last year, the class is still the largest in the county. The graduating class: Athlene King, Evelyn Williams, Jessie Lee Skidmore, Jeanette Bolling, Marjorie Newberry, Pauline Rasnic, Frankie Fannon, Blanche Hyden, Dettie Hall, Mary Ann Laningham, Mary Margaret Smalley, Margaret Sue Travis, Margaret Rasnic, Virginia Ward, Vivian Oaks, Willie Orr, Richelieu Orr, Mary Lou Smith, Dorothy Castle, Eloise "Weegie" Rogers, Annie Hammonds, Mary Ella Wooliver, LElizabeth Ann Wynn, Beatrice Helbert, Ray Burns, Richard Blackwell, Hubert Hammonds, Billy Olinger, Jimmy Moore, Curtis Chinault, Eugene Simcox, James Earl Scroggs, Jay Kauffman, Clyde ___, Randell Farley, Henderson, Gibson, and others. R. E. Beller, Jr. of Pennington High School is rounding out his tenth year as principal. He is a graduate of William and Mary College and has taught in Lee County Schools for sixteen years.
